A package structure of an integrated circuit device comprises a copper foil substrate, an integrated circuit device, a plurality of metal wires and an encapsulation material. The copper foil substrate comprises an IC bonding area, a plurality of conductive areas and an insulating dielectric material. The integrated circuit device is mounted on the surface of the IC bonding area, and is electrically connected to the plurality of conductive areas through the metal wires. The insulating dielectric material is between the IC bonding area and the conductive areas, and is also between two adjacent conductive areas. In addition, the encapsulation material covers the IC bonding area, the conductive areas and the integrated circuit device.

A method for transmitting information includes a NodeB receiving information reported by a User Equipment (UE) through an Enhanced Dedicated Channel (E-DCH) transmission channel, and determining the UE corresponding to the received information according to UE ID information carried in the received information. A system and NodeB for transmitting information are also provided. When random access data is transmitted between the UE and the NodeB, the NodeB can determine the UE from which the data is received, thus ensuring practicability of the transmission solution that uses High Speed Uplink Packet Access (HSUPA) to implement random access.

A ceramic package structure of a high power light emitting diode comprises a light emitting diode die, a ceramic substrate, at least two conductive rods, and an electrical conductive film. The ceramic substrate comprises a first surface and a second surface opposite the first surface. A reflecting cup is disposed on the first surface. At least two through holes are disposed on the bottom of the reflecting cup. The electrical conductive film comprises a first electrode and a second electrode, and is fixed to the second surface. The at least two conductive rods are respectively filled in the at least two through holes, and are respectively connected to the first electrode and the second electrode. The LED diode is mounted on one or at least two of the conductive rods, and is electrically connected to the at least two conductive rods.

An error correction apparatus comprises an input for receiving data. The received data includes error-check data. The apparatus also includes a processing resource arranged to calculate parity check data. A data store is coupled to the processing resource for storing look-up data for identifying, when in use, a location of an error in the received data. The look-up data is a compressed form of indexed error location data.

Disclosed is an apparatus and method of power-saving and wake-up, which is not only used to reduce the power consumption of a system of electronic equipment, but also allow the system to immediately return to normal operation according to the requirement. The apparatus for power-saving and wake-up includes a first detector, a second detector, a decoder and a third detector. The method for power-saving and wake-up includes detecting a cable signal, a clock pair signal and a differential pair signal. When one of the detected signals is unusual, the system soon turns off the unusual channel power and implement the procedures for power saving and operates under the power saving mode, which can realize the effect of power saving and low power consumption. The method for power-saving and wake-up includes detecting the cable signal, the toggling and frequency of the clock signal and the synchronizing signals of the system.

The present invention relates to an arithmetic decoding system and apparatus based on the adaptive content. The system includes a control unit, a decoding unit and an interface unit. The control unit fills the code stream data into the decoding unit and configures and controls the decoding unit through the interface unit. The decoding unit performs a decoding for all the syntax elements from the code stream data in the macro block, assembles the syntax elements and transmits them to the control unit. The interface unit transfers the interaction information between the decoding unit and the control unit. The present invention obtains syntax elements by the CABAC decoding through hardware so that the decoding efficiency is highly improved and the requirements for the video processing speed and the data processing capacity of the real-time and high definition applications are satisfied.

The invention discloses a sink device. The sink device comprises a buffering unit and a clock generating unit. The buffering unit receives a decoding data according to a symbol clock signal, reads the decoding data according to a pixel clock signal, and generates a water level value. The clock generating unit receives the symbol clock signal to generate the pixel clock signal and adjusts a rate of the pixel clock signal according to the water level value and/or a phase difference signal.
